Welcome to the ChipGate review! Our timing-chip readers at the Larkspur Marathon push split times to the PaceLedger service every few seconds. Nothing fancy: readers authenticate once at boot, then stream over TLS. For your audit, you'll want to poke at the ingest endpoint directly. Use the key below to authenticate your test calls.

gateway credential: kto3_qfe

## Runbook: Harlowmark markdown pipeline hiccups

If rendered pages come out with raw fence markers, the Quenby sanitizer stage probably crashed mid-batch. Restart the worker pool, then re-enqueue only the failed documents — a full replay will clobber the cache. Give it ten minutes before escalating. When filing the incident note, include the trace token shown just below.

build token for fahap-yawig: htk3_9d7

### Action Item: Spoolhaven Retry Storm

From last Tuesday's outage: the Spoolhaven print service retried failed jobs without backoff, saturating the render pool. Fix merged; retries now use capped exponential backoff with jitter. Owner will monitor for a week before closing. The agreed retry constants are recorded below.

constants for yadup-kajof:
RATE_LIMITS = {
    "zorwyn": 1,
    "druwyn": 1,
}